The 26th Art Directors Guild Excellence in Production Design Awards, honoring the best production designers in film, television and media of 2021, was held on March 5, 2022, at the InterContinental Hotel in Los Angeles, California, United States.[1] The nominations were announced on January 24, 2022.[2]
Denis Villeneuve was awarded with the William Cameron Menzies Award, while Jane Campion received the Cinematic Imagery Award.[3][4]
